zoukankan      html  css  js  c++  java
  • 在linux服务器下JMeter如何执行jmx性能脚本

    准备环境:linux平台、jmeter安装包、 jdk
     
    一、 安装jdk
           jdk的安装可以参考以下内容
           
    vi/ect/profile
    shift+G跳转到最后一行
    shift+4跳转到最后一行数值
    按i 移动光标至最后一行
    shift+insert 复制内容
    Jmeter_Home=/usr/local/jmeter
    MAVEN_HOME=/home/maven
    JAVA_HOME=/home/java/jdk1.8.0_152
    PATH=$JAVA_home/bin:$ANT_HOME/bin:${MAVEN_HOME}/bin:${Jmeter_Home}/bin:$PATH
    CLASSPATH=$Jmeter_Home/jre/lib/ext:$JAVA_HOME/lib/tools.jar:$Jmeter_Home/lib/ext/ApacheJMeter_core.jar:$Jmeter_Home/lib/jorphan.jar:$Jmeter_Home/lib/logkit-2.0.jar:
    export PATH JAVA_HOME Jmeter_Home ANT_HOME MAVEN_HOME CLASSPATH
     
    二、 安装jmeter
            1.将jmeter压缩包上传至linux的指定目录下。
           

            2.解压压缩包

             unzip apache-jmeter-3.1.zip

            3.给jmeter.sh 赋权 ,进到解压目录的 /jmeter/bin 下
               chmod 777 jmeter.sh,用  sh jmeter.sh -v 来检测命令是否安装成功

             

            4、上传测试计划.jmx 文件

                 新建存放jmx脚本文件目录。   cd 到/jmeter/bin 目录,mkdir  data

            5、执行jmx脚本

                 pwd    查看jmx完整目录,  查询结果为:  /home/jmeter/bin/data

                 因此执行指令为:      /home/jmeter/bin/data/jmeter.sh -n -t  /home/jmeter/bin/data/test01.jmx

            6、查看执行结果

                 执行完成之后,可以看到查看到 summary =  Tps / Avg / Max / Min

                 cat testResults.txt

                       

                 

                 

                  

       

               
  • 相关阅读:
    vue通过webpack打包后怎么运行
    vue中请求本地的json数据
    electron打包成桌面应用程序的详细介绍
    Web应用架构-Services
    Web应用架构-Full-text Search Service
    Web应用架构-Job Queue & Servers
    Web应用架构-Caching Service
    Web应用架构-Database
    设计模式:设计模式概述&JDK中的应用
    常见面试问题总结
  • 原文地址:https://www.cnblogs.com/Shanghai-vame/p/10705113.html
Copyright © 2011-2022 走看看